Longs, SC – Four Injured in Multi-Vehicle Crash on Old Hwy 31

Longs, SC – Four Injured in Multi-Vehicle Crash on Old Hwy 31
November 1, 2025

Longs, SC (November 01, 2025) – Four people were injured on October 31 in a multi-vehicle crash in the Longs community area of Horry County, South Carolina, according to officials from Horry County Fire Rescue.

The crash occurred around 10:45 p.m. on Old Highway 31, between Highways 90 and 905. Reports indicate the incident involved three vehicles, including a motorcycle, and included vehicle entrapment and an overturned car. Emergency crews responded promptly to the scene to assist the injured.

Firefighters and rescue personnel worked to extricate at least one person from a trapped vehicle. All four individuals who sustained injuries were transported by Horry County EMS to nearby hospitals for evaluation and treatment. Authorities have not yet released the severity of their injuries.

The South Carolina Highway Patrol is leading the investigation into the crash, with assistance from the Horry County Police Department. Investigators are examining the cause of the collision, which may include factors such as speeding, driver distraction, or unsafe lane changes.

Multi-Vehicle and Motorcycle Accidents in Horry County

Multi-vehicle crashes, especially those involving motorcycles, pose serious risks to drivers and passengers alike. In Horry County and across South Carolina, motorcycle accidents are more likely to result in severe injuries due to the lack of protective structure compared to cars. Collisions can result in head injuries, broken bones, road rash, and internal trauma, particularly when a motorcycle is involved.

According to the South Carolina Department of Public Safety, intersection and roadway accidents are leading causes of injuries in the state, with motorcycle riders disproportionately represented in serious collisions. Common contributing factors include speeding, distracted driving, impaired driving, and failure to maintain lane control.

Multi-vehicle crashes can also escalate quickly, as secondary collisions often occur when vehicles try to swerve or stop suddenly to avoid impact.

Victims of multi-vehicle or motorcycle crashes often face extensive medical care, rehabilitation, and financial hardship. Beyond immediate treatment, long-term recovery may include physical therapy, lost wages, and emotional stress.
